I find scaled maxspect works the best with my Xinerama setup, which is a bit
weird because it has one monitor at 1600x1200 and one at 1280x1024 with a
screen area of 1280x1200 (so both monitors have the same height, so that I
don't have an un-mouseable space).
Running with scaled maxpect, the picture is the right proportion on both
monitors, it is just cut off a tiny bit on the smaller one.
Before this, for a few months I also had my background set by a script that
used imagemagick to compost two pictures.
But yes, it sure would be nice to have native support for two backgrounds in
kcontrol.
